Media players of this era often enter a deep-discharge protection state after a cell swap, and the charge IC needs to push a slow trickle current before it accepts a normal charge rate.\u003c\/li\u003e\n  \u003c\/ul\u003e\n\n  \u003chr class=\"bpw-desc-divider\"\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eBattery percentage jumping erratically after cell swap\u003c\/h3\u003e\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The NW-HD1 uses a voltage-threshold method to estimate remaining charge — it does not have a fuel gauge IC that recalibrates automatically. After fitting a new cell, the device's charge indicator is reading a voltage curve it hasn't mapped yet. Run two or three full charge-to-empty cycles and the readings stabilise. If the display still jumps after three cycles, check that the connector is fully seated — a loose pin causes intermittent voltage spikes the indicator reads as charge swings.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003ePlayback cuts out before the battery indicator shows empty\u003c\/h3\u003e\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The NW-HD1's audio amplifier draws a short current spike to drive headphone output, and near the end of the cell's discharge curve — typically below 3.5V — the cell can no longer sustain that spike without voltage sagging below the device's cutoff threshold. The player shuts down to protect the cell even though the indicator shows charge remaining. This is a normal characteristic of aged or cold Li-Polymer cells. If it happens frequently, the cell may have aged past usable capacity — check open-circuit voltage after a full charge; a healthy cell should read 4.1–4.2V.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e","brand":"BatteryWeb","offers":[{"title":"Warranty 1 Year","offer_id":43381353185370,"sku":"BWCS-HD1SL-1","price":23.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 2 Year","offer_id":43381353218138,"sku":"BWCS-HD1SL-2","price":26.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 3 Year","offer_id":43381353250906,"sku":"BWCS-HD1SL-3","price":28.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0674\/4775\/0746\/files\/BW-CS-HD1SL_1.webp?v=1778900175","url":"https:\/\/batteryweb.com\/products\/sony-nw-hd1-mp3-player-replacement-battery-37v-800mah-li-polymer","provider":"BatteryWeb","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
